**Vendor note: Inkmill markdown pipeline**

Rendering for Parchway docs is outsourced to Inkmill under an annual contract, renewing each March. They handle sanitization and PDF export; we own the upload queue. SLA: 4-hour response on rendering failures. Escalate only after two failed retries. Their support desk is reachable at the address below.

billing contact of hahaf-baguf = zorael.tammir.jorius@sivrelhq.internal

Test Plan — FlumeSock Compression Trial

Goal: decide between permessage-deflate and Breck's custom frame packing for the FlumeSock gateway. Measure CPU on relay nodes, bandwidth savings, and tail latency at 10k concurrent sockets. Runs: baseline, deflate level 6, custom packer. Abort any run where p99 exceeds 250 ms. Results table lands in the Varnhold release doc Thursday. Load harness hits the staging relay, which expects the bearer credential printed below.

session JWT of yawep-yawep = eyJhbGciOiJIUzI1NiIsInR5cCI6IkpXVCJ9.eyJzdWIiOiI3pWF3_In0.aXYsHiog

# Break-Glass: Catalog Cache Invalidation

Scope: the Pinrow product catalog at Veldstone Retail. If stale prices persist after a purge and the Hollowmere invalidation queue is wedged, use break-glass to flush the edge tier directly. Contractors: get verbal sign-off from the catalog lead first. Steps: open the Hollowmere admin shell, select emergency-flush, confirm the tenant, and run it once — repeated flushes thrash the origin. Access is logged and expires after 20 minutes. Unseal the admin shell with the passphrase below.

recovery phrase for kahop-tajog: istix-casvan

## Authentication

Heads up, future maintainers: the Pinwheel profile store is sharded across 16 nodes keyed on user-ID hash, and every shard sits behind the same auth proxy. You don't talk to shards directly — you talk to the proxy, and it routes for you. That means one credential covers the whole fleet, which is convenient but also why rotation matters (rotate quarterly, it's in the runbook).

Set the credential in your env before running migrations or the rebalancer. For local dev against staging, use the key below.

API key for fadug-fafof: kto7_7rjklQM